This striking antique Chinese kang cabinet from Gansu carries a sense of quiet reverence and rustic charm. Originating from Gansu Province, pieces like this would have served not only as practical storage for clothes and bedding but also as a central altar for ancestor worship within the family home. The painted panels are beautifully timeworn whilst retaining intact imagery - give a great "Wabi-Sabi" look. They are delicately adorned with still-life and narrative imagery, framed by scalloped borders and set against a softly distressed natural wood frame. Each mark of age tells a story, adding layers of authenticity and soul to this piece.

Inside, the cabinet offers generous storage behind four doors, fitted with an internal shelf, spanning the length of the sideboard. Whether placed in a hallway, dining area, or repurposed as a media unit, this sideboard blends functionality with cultural heritage.

  • Origin: Gansu Province, Northern China
  • Date: 19th century
  • Materials: Pine & cedar wood with original painted panels
  • Features: Four doors with internal shelving; hand-painted figural and floral & fruit bowl scenes; distressed finish with original patina
  • Condition: Excellent structural condition with surface wear and faded paint consistent with age
  • Dimensions: W173 x D44 x H60 cm
